Output 5d77c54c187695a6dfea455315801e0fbe3f29dc9053243af4e060b534eaae9b:0

value
580300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 682eee8ab104491116bc19e491550dc0abd8c77c OP_EQUAL
address
3BBtRNb4PSMixJBamZq5NF2XRxKvEpTiyv
transaction
5d77c54c187695a6dfea455315801e0fbe3f29dc9053243af4e060b534eaae9b
spent
true